Members of Group Executive Committee

Name Member of Group Executive Committee Share-holding1) Education and experience
Olof Faxander, President and CEO (1970) 2) 2006 10,000 shares M.Sc. (Materials Science) and B.Sc. (Business Administration).
Employed at SSAB since 2006.
Formerly Executive Vice President of Outokumpu.
Jonas Bergstrand, General Counsel and Executive Vice President, Legal (1965) 2006 5,242 shares Master of Law.
Employed at SSAB since 2006.
Formerly corporate counsel at ABB; OM Gruppen; Ericsson Radio Systems.
David Britten, Executive Vice President, Head of Business Area SSAB Americas (1960) 2008 5,000 shares M.Sc. (Engineering).
Employed at SSAB since 2007.
Formerly Executive Vice President, IPSCO.
Martin Lindqvist, Executive Vice President, Head of Busines Area SSAB EMEA (1962) 2) 3) 2001 17,109 shares B.Sc (Economics). Employed at SSAB since 1998.
Formerly CFO at SSAB, CFO at SSAB Strip Products and Chief Controller at NCC.
Martin Pei, Executive Vice President, Head of Business Area SSAB APAC (1963) 2007 1,000 shares Ph. D. (Technology).
Employed at SSAB since 2001.
Formerly Head of Research and Development; General Manager, Slab Production, SSAB Plate.
Karl-Gustav Ramström, Executive Vice President, Head of Group Marketing and Market Development (1954) 2007 1,000 shares Master of Engineering, MBA.
Employed at SSAB since 2007.
Formerly Head of Division, Svenska ABB.
Helena Stålnert, Executive Vice President, Communications (1951) 2007 500 shares Master program in Journalism.
Employed at SSAB since 2007.
Formerly Senior Vice President, Communications at Saab, Editor-in-Chief Aktuellt Swedish Television.
Anna Vikström Persson, Executive Vice President, Human Resources (1970) 2006 3,500 shares Master of Law.
Employed at SSAB since 2006.
Formerly Head of Human Resources at Ericsson's Swedish operations.
Marco Wirén, Chief Financial Officer and Executive Vice President, Finance (1966) 2008 8,700 shares Master in Economics.
Employed at SSAB since 2007.
Formerly Chief Controller at SSAB and CFO at Eltel Networks AB and Vice President, Strategic Planning and Group Controller at NCC.

1) Shareholdings as of December 31, 2010 and include shares owned by closely-related persons.
2) As of January 1, 2011 Martin Lindqvist is President and CEO in SSAB.
3) Thom Mathisen is acting Head of Business Area SSAB EMEA.
